So in 2019, like three dudes took off with a golden, an 18-carat golden toilet that was taken from Blenheim Palace, which is where Winston Churchill was born. This was back in 2019. They never recovered it because they're like,
Starting point is 00:06:55 well, they probably cut up this solid piece of gold and sold it because it's a shit ton of gold. In fact, it weighed just over 215 pounds and was insured for 4.8 million pounds sterling, which is around $6 million. The value of the gold at that time was about three and a half million dollars. And it was previously on display at the Guggenheim and then made its way to the UK.
